//编译原理
{
1.高级语言与编译{
1.1编译程序概论
1.2高级程序语言概述
1.3过程与函数执行的分析方法
}
2.词法分析{
2.1状态转换图
2.2正规表达式与有限自动机
2.3正规式到有限自动机的变换
}
3.语法分析{
3.1上下文无关文法
3.2自下而上分析
3.3算符优先分析法
3.4自上而下分析
}
4.语法分析器的自动构造{
4.1LR分析器基本知识
4.2LR0分析表的构造
4.3SLR分析表的构造
4.4规范LR分析表的构造
4.5LALR分析表的构造
4.6二义文法的应用
}
5.中间代码生成{
5.1中间语言简介
5.2布尔表达式与典型语句翻译
}
6.程序运行时存贮空间组织{
6.1静态存贮分配
6.2简单的栈式存贮分配
6.3嵌套过程语言的栈式分配
6.4分程序结构的存储管理
}
7.代码优化{
7.1局部优化
7.2循环查找
7.3到达——定值与引用——定值链
7.4循环优化
}
8.符号表与错误处理
}
编译原理
最新推荐文章于 2023-06-22 16:14:13 发布